Output 17fe53c926f6d0e0575db566ede1e4896a94031df2f54ec8a96c654aa88fcd0a:0

value
400012804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
17fe53c926f6d0e0575db566ede1e4896a94031df2f54ec8a96c654aa88fcd0a
spent
true